Sustainable Finance Analyst A **sustainable finance analyst** plays a crucial role in developing and implementing environmentally friendly financial strategies for organizations. They analyze data to identify areas of improvement and create plans to reduce carbon footprint and promote sustainable practices. Renewable Energy Engineer A **renewable energy engineer** designs and develops systems that harness renewable energy sources such as solar and wind power. They work to reduce reliance on fossil fuels and mitigate climate change. Artificial Intelligence and Machine Learning Specialist An **artificial intelligence and machine learning specialist** uses AI and machine learning algorithms to analyze data and make predictions about sustainable finance trends. They help organizations make informed decisions about investments and risk management. Data Scientist A **data scientist** collects and analyzes data to identify patterns and trends in sustainable finance. They use this information to develop predictive models and create data visualizations to communicate insights to stakeholders. Economist An **economist** studies the relationship between economic systems and the environment. They analyze data to understand the impact of economic policies on sustainable finance and develop recommendations for policymakers.
